Structural Engineer Jobs in Kansas City: Frequently Asked Questions

How do I get a structural engineer job in Kansas City?

Focus on Kansas City's strongest hiring sectors: transportation infrastructure, commercial real estate development, and civil engineering consulting. Firms working on the city's ongoing bridge rehabilitation, mixed-use development downtown, and utility projects hire consistently. Candidates with RISA, SAP2000, or Revit proficiency stand out locally. Targeting mid-size engineering consultancies in the Crossroads and Westport areas, rather than only large nationals, often yields faster results in this market.

Are there remote structural engineer jobs in Kansas City?

Yes, though remote work is less common for structural engineers than for purely desk-based roles, since site visits, inspections, and client coordination often require in-person presence. About 9% of structural engineer openings tied to Kansas City are remote or hybrid as of July 2026, with hybrid arrangements most common. Analysis, modeling, and design review tasks are the portions most often done remotely in Kansas City-based roles.

How can I get a structural engineer job in Kansas City with little or no experience?

The most realistic entry path in Kansas City is through engineering internships or junior EIT roles at regional consulting firms. Companies supporting the city's infrastructure projects and commercial construction pipeline regularly bring on entry-level engineers for drafting, load calculations, and field support. A Professional Engineer exam study plan, AutoCAD or Revit proficiency, and familiarity with local building codes help candidates stand out when competing for these roles.
